Witryna28 kwi 2024 · Impulsive behavior can lead you to appear quite irresponsible in your partner’s eyes. It makes sense because repeated spending sprees or risky sex can come with serious consequences. Your significant other may come to view you as being a child they have to take responsibility for, rather than an equal partner. Witryna13 mar 2024 · Impulse control sometimes known as self-control or our inhibition is an executive functioning skill that allows us to engage independently in society. Impulse control strategies help us “think before acting” and to prioritize longer-term rewards over short-term gain. Witryna8 lip 2016 · This can result in a greater likelihood of engagement in risky behaviors, alone and/or in groups, in an attempt to elevate social status. A great deal of research shows that poor cognitive control and the tendency toward impulsive behavior influence the ability to make reasonable choices in daily-life situations during adolescence.
